When's the best time to book a family-friendly holiday in Maidenhead?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Maidenhead is 695 mm.
What's there to see and do with your family in Maidenhead?
Bray Marina and Chiltern Hills are interesting attractions that you and your family may enjoy exploring while you are staying in Maidenhead. Make sure that you have plenty of time to take in activities in the area such as Warner Bros. Studio Tour London and LEGOLAND® Windsor.
What's the best way for us to get around Maidenhead?
If you want to travel outside the city, take a train from Maidenhead Station, Maidenhead Furze Platt Station or Maidenhead Taplow Station. Maidenhead might not have very many public transport options to choose from, so consider renting a car to explore more.
